If you’re considering a move to Wichita, the Schweiter neighborhood in the southeast part of the city is definitely worth exploring. This charming area offers a welcoming community vibe combined with convenient access to a variety of amenities that make day-to-day life enjoyable. One of the standout features of Schweiter is its proximity to several parks and green spaces, perfect for families and outdoor enthusiasts who enjoy weekend picnics, jogging, or simply spending time in nature. The local schools in this neighborhood are well-regarded, making it an attractive option for families with children. Additionally, Schweiter’s residential streets feature a mix of well-maintained single-family homes, providing options for different tastes and budgets.

For those who appreciate shopping and dining options nearby, Schweiter does not disappoint. Residents can enjoy easy trips to popular local spots like the Towne East Square Mall, which offers everything from boutique shops to major retail stores. Food lovers will appreciate the range of eateries offering everything from classic American fare to international cuisine within a short drive. Plus, the neighborhood is close to essential services including grocery stores, healthcare facilities, and fitness centers, making errands and daily routines hassle-free. The vibrant community also often hosts local events and gatherings that help residents feel connected and engaged.

One major advantage of living in Schweiter is its convenient commute to Downtown Wichita, which is roughly a 15 to 20-minute drive depending on traffic. This makes it easy for professionals working in the city center to enjoy a quieter, more suburban lifestyle without sacrificing access to the bustling downtown scene. Whether you’re heading to work, catching a show at the Century II Performing Arts & Convention Center, or exploring the unique shops and restaurants downtown, Schweiter’s location strikes a great balance between peaceful living and urban convenience. Housing trends offer valuable insight into the accessibility and character of a neighborhood. In Schweiter, the median home price is $91,725, which is less than many surrounding areas. This affordability makes it an attractive option for first-time buyers, young families, or anyone looking to enter the housing market without a significant financial barrier. Looking at appreciation rates and past market trends in Schweiter can offer valuable insight into the neighborhood’s investment potential. Understanding how home values have changed over time helps buyers gauge future growth, assess long-term stability, and make more informed real estate decisions.

The median rent is around $916, which is on par with many comparable neighborhoods. This balanced pricing offers a mix of affordability and value, making it a practical choice for a wide range of renters.
